If the phone is clicking at you, that means that Voice Over is running. 
If it's not talking, that means that the voice within Voice Over is 
turned off. If the screen is not displaying anything, that means the 
Voice Over screen curtain is on. If that is the phone's condition, the 
easiest way to fix it is to quickly press the home key (the round key at 
the bottom) three times. That should turn off Voice Over and give you 
your screen display back. If there are things your son is helping you 
set up, he will want to do it with Voice Over off because interacting 
with the screen will be different than if it were running. 
Triple-tapping the home key again should restart Voice Over, again 
activating the screen curtain but leaving you with the voice on. Tapping 
twice with three fingers will toggle the speech on and off when Voice 
Over is running. I hope all this gives you a starting point. Restarting 
the phone may not help because it will come up in the same condition it 
is now.
